卫星定位操作系统应用:如何将操作系统与卫星定位结合

时间:2025-04-21 12:48:26 分类:操作系统

卫星定位系统,作为现代科技中不可或缺的一部分,已深入到人们生活的方方面面。从智能手机到车载导航,再到无人机和自动驾驶汽车,卫星定位的应用展现出了其广泛的前景。这一趋势不止于此,未来操作系统在卫星定位技术中的应用将会更加深入和完善。

卫星定位操作系统应用:如何将操作系统与卫星定位结合

结合操作系统与卫星定位,不仅仅是将定位功能集成在设备中,更是通过优化操作系统的设计来提升定位的准确性与效率。当前市场上,各大技术厂商纷纷致力于提升设备的导航和定位能力,为操作系统赋予更多可能。例如,Android和iOS操作系统如今都已经支持高精度的GNSS(全球导航卫星系统),用户可以通过软件接口获得更为精准的定位信息。

在DIY组装方面,越来越多的爱好者开始探索如何在个人项目中集成卫星定位技术。以树莓派(Raspberry Pi)为例,借助外部GNSS模块和相应的软件库,用户可以轻松搭建自己的卫星定位系统。这对于开发者和技术狂热者来说,提供了无限可能性。在这种自制项目中,操作系统为GNSS模块的管理、数据处理和用户接口提供了基础,提升了整个系统的易用性和功能性。

针对性能优化,操作系统的设计者们也在持续探索新的方案。一些现代操作系统通过多线程和异步编程等方式,能有效地处理实时数据流,确保在高速移动中定位的稳定与准确。针对不同的应用场景,定制化的操作系统可以进一步优化资源的分配,例如在无人机应用中,必须在保证定位准确性的节省电源与计算资源。

企业与开发者还应关注市场的演变。随着智能设备和物联网的普及,各类基于卫星导航的服务对操作系统的需求越来越高。未来,程序开发将逐渐向着简化复杂的定位流程和提高用户体验的方向发展。例如,通过云计算的应用,将定位服务的计算移至云端,有可能在未来大大提高系统的整体性能。

卫星定位与操作系统的结合在不断深化,推动着科技的进步与应用的多样化。无论是在市场趋势的把握,还是在DIY组装与性能优化中,只有不断学习和实践,才能在这一领域中把握先机。

常见问题解答

1. 卫星定位系统与操作系统结合有哪些实际应用?

- 常见应用包括导航设备、无人机、智能手机及资产管理系统等。

2. 如何在树莓派上实现卫星定位系统?

- 可以购买GNSS模块,使用操作系统配置串口通信,并利用相应的开发库接收定位数据。

3. 什么是GNSS,为什么重要?

- GNSS即全球导航卫星系统,是提供定位、导航和授时服务的技术,准确性是许多智能应用的关键。

4. 如何优化卫星定位系统的性能?

- 引入多线程处理、使用异步API、优化算法和数据流管理是提升性能的有效方法。

5. 未来卫星定位与操作系统结合的趋势是什么?

- 未来将向云计算和边缘计算发展,提供更高效、实时的定位服务,同时增强用户体验。